fork download
  1. #include <iostream>
  2.  
  3. struct pt
  4. {
  5. double a;
  6. pt(double a) : a(a) {};
  7.  
  8. void operator*=(const pt& x) {
  9. a *= x.a;
  10. }
  11. };
  12.  
  13. int main()
  14. {
  15. pt p(10);
  16.  
  17. p *= 20.0;
  18.  
  19. std::cout << p.a << '\n';
  20. }
Success #stdin #stdout 0.01s 2724KB
stdin
Standard input is empty
stdout
200